As a Financial Analyst, my daily routine was rigorous, revolving around data acquisition, processing, and interpretation. The core responsibilities included:
- Budget Forecasting and Variance Analysis: I assisted in the preparation of quarterly budgets for three major clients in the logistics sector based in Italy Naples. This involved tracking actual expenditures against projected figures, identifying variances greater than five percent, and providing actionable recommendations to management. Understanding seasonality was critical here; unlike industrial zones that run consistently year-round, businesses in Italy Naples, particularly those tied to tourism and port activities, exhibited significant fluctuation during summer months.
- Cash Flow Management: One of the most challenging yet rewarding tasks was optimizing cash flow statements. Many local enterprises operate on tight margins and rely heavily on trade credit. My role involved modeling different payment scenarios to ensure liquidity while maintaining positive vendor relationships. This required a deep understanding of local banking practices in Southern Italy, where access to traditional financing can sometimes be more restricted than in the North.
- Risk Assessment: I contributed to the risk assessment framework for potential investment projects. This included analyzing exchange rate risks for clients importing raw materials and evaluating regulatory changes affecting labor costs within Italy. The report required a nuanced approach, considering both macroeconomic indicators specific to the European Union and microeconomic realities of the Italy Naples market.
- Financial Modeling: I built and maintained complex Excel models to project future performance metrics for startup clients seeking venture capital. These models were not just numbers; they were narratives that had to convince investors of the viability of projects rooted in the local culture and economy of Italy Naples.

The transition from academic study to professional practice presented several hurdles. Initially, the complexity of Italian tax laws was daunting. Navigating VAT regulations and regional subsidies specific to Campania required constant consultation with legal teams and continuous self-education.
Another challenge was resistance to change within traditional family-owned businesses in Italy Naples. Implementing new financial controls often met with skepticism from long-standing management teams accustomed to informal accounting methods. To overcome this, I focused on demonstrating tangible benefits, such as reduced administrative burden or increased audit readiness, rather than merely imposing new protocols.
